THCa (tetrahydrocannabinolic acid) can be a Obviously occurring substance present in all forms of cannabis. It’s the acidic precursor to THC, and its primary attraction is the fact it turns into Delta-9-THC soon after a specific chemical process.

Just about the most widespread and available approaches for ingesting THCA is by using cannabis tea. Because THCA is a lot more water-soluble than THC, a cup of cannabis tea will primarily produce THCA with minimal amounts of THC. The recent drinking water only converts a little bit THCA to THC because decarboxylation demands higher temperatures to come about swiftly.
